It is narrated from Sayyiduna Abdullah bin Amr bin al-As (may Allah be pleased with them both) that the Noble Prophet (peace and blessings be upon him and his family) said: Whoever remained silent, attained salvation.
Hadith Referenceالفتح الربانی / كتاب آفات اللسان / 9871
Hadith Gradingمحدثین:صحیح
Hadith Takhrij«حديث حسن، أخرجه الترمذي: 2501 ، (انظر مسند أحمد ترقيم الرسالة: 6654 ترقیم بيت الأفكار الدولية: 6654»
Sayyiduna Abu Hurairah (may Allah be pleased with him) narrates that the Messenger of Allah (peace and blessings be upon him) said: Whoever believes in Allah and the Last Day should honor his guest; whoever believes in Allah and the Last Day should not harm his neighbor; and whoever believes in Allah and the Last Day should speak good or remain silent.
Hadith Referenceالفتح الربانی / كتاب آفات اللسان / 9872
Hadith Gradingمحدثین:صحیح
Hadith Takhrij«اسناده صحيح علي شرط الشيخين، أخرجه الطبراني في الاوسط : 8841 ، (انظر مسند أحمد ترقيم الرسالة: 9970 ترقیم بيت الأفكار الدولية: 9971»
